Being a disinfectant, hydrogen peroxide may reduce the potential risk of infection and reduce inflammation and pain associated with ingrown … WebTreat the toe by soaking your feet in warm water with Epsom salt for 10-15 minutes. Dry your feet, apply an antibiotic and bandage, and take acetaminophen as needed. Your doctor can also surgically remove the ingrown nail if it does not heal on its own. Prevent ingrown nails by wearing comfortable footwear and cutting your nails straight across.
WebShould you dig out an ingrown toenail? A common approach to ingrown toenails is to “dig them out.” Podiatrists caution against this. When cutting out your ingrown toenail, you might lacerate the skin, making it easy for an infection to set in. The following steps are good ways to provide home care: Soak your feet in warm water several times daily. Wear sandals. Apply antibacterial ointment. Trim your ingrown toenail straight across the top.
